Virtual Workshop: How to use the docking software GOLD to perform virtual screening simulations
In Online
In drug discovery, Virtual Screening (VS) is a widely used computational method to search libraries of small molecules for hit identification, lead optimization, and scaffold hopping. Virtual Screening can reduce research time and cost by using two different approaches: Structure-Based Virtual Screening (SBVS) and Ligand-Based Virtual Screening (LBVS).
What we will cover
In this virtual workshop, we will familiarise you with the Hermes GUI and learn how to set up and run a virtual screening campaign in GOLD. The session will include presentations and demonstrations by CCDC expert tutors and a hands-on part for you to try the software, with the tutors available to help you and answer your questions.
You will learn:
- Brief overview of structure-based virtual screening.
- Basics of the Hermes interface, the CCDC’s 3D visualizer for proteins.
- Cavity detection and extraction in Hermes.
- Step-by-step set-up of a virtual screening simulation in GOLD.
- Analysis of virtual screening results.
- Protein-ligand interactions insights using hotspots via Superstar.

2025 Pittsburgh Diffraction Conference (PDC)
Hosted by Brookhaven National Laboratory
October 9–12, 2025
On behalf of the Conference Committee, we are delighted to invite you to 82nd annual Pittsburgh Diffraction Conference (PDC). This year’s conference will be held October 9–12, 2025 at Brookhaven National Laboratory, on New York’s beautiful Long Island.
The Pittsburgh Diffraction Conference is one of the longest-running scientific meetings in North America focused on the advancement of structural science through diffraction-based methods. Bridging both life sciences and materials sciences, the conference brings together researchers who utilize laboratory-based instruments, X-ray light sources, electron diffraction, and neutron scattering to explore the structure and dynamics of matter. It serves as a vibrant forum for sharing recent scientific breakthroughs, fostering interdisciplinary collaborations, and highlighting innovations across experimental and computational frontiers
This year’s program features a diverse and timely selection of breakout sessions, reflecting key areas of growth in the field. Topics include energy storage, emphasizing structural insights that enable next-generation energy technologies; AI and its applications in the development of emergent materials; novel materials with transformative properties; and the effects of extreme environments on structures, reveling details on dynamic processes and molecular motion that lead to biomolecular functions and a better understanding of complex soft materials.

We are excited to announce the International School on Electron Crystallography, which will be held in the charming town of Erice, Italy, from 30 May - 7 June 2025. This event will bring together leading experts, researchers, and students in the field of electron crystallography to explore the latest developments and techniques.
Dates: 30 May - 7 June 2025
Location: Ettore Majorana Foundation and Centre for Scientific Culture, Erice, Italy
About the School:
The International School on Electron Crystallography offers a comprehensive learning experience for participants at all levels, from beginners to advanced researchers. Through lectures, hands-on tutorials, and interactive sessions, attendees will gain valuable insights into the principles and applications of electron crystallography, including electron diffraction, 3D electron diffraction (3D ED), structure determination, and the latest innovations in the field.
Key Topics:
Fundamentals of electron crystallography and diffraction
3D electron diffraction techniques
Structure determination of molecular and inorganic materials
Applications in nanomaterials, pharmaceuticals, and structural biology
Recent advances in instrumentation and data analysis
Who Should Attend:
The school is designed for students, postdocs, and professionals working in electron microscopy, crystallography, materials science, chemistry, physics, and related disciplines. Whether you are new to electron crystallography or looking to deepen your expertise, this school provides a unique opportunity to expand your knowledge and network with experts in the field.

Free Virtual Workshop: Validate Molecular Conformations With Informatics Software Mogul
|
In Online
Mogul enables you to assess the geometry of your molecule through comparison with data from the over 1.3 million expertly curated structures in the Cambridge Structural Database (CSD).
You will learn hands-on how to run a Mogul geometry check in Mercury and how to interpret the results.
What we will cover You will explore how to assess the geometry of a molecule against the structures in the CSD and how to interpret the results. The session will include presentations and demonstrations by CCDC expert tutors and a hands-on part for you to try the software, with the tutors available to help you and answer your questions.
You will learn: - How to run a Mogul geometry check in Mercury. - How to interpret the results obtained. - How to restrict the geometry check to a specific feature of a loaded molecule and how to filter the results. - How Mogul has been used by scientists globally through case studies. - How to use CSD Conformer Generator (built from Mogul data) to generate plausible conformers of compounds of interest. - The workshop will be recorded and all registered participants will have access to the recording.
